About the Position

The Medical Device Reprocessing (MDR) program at Lethbridge Polytechnic prepares students to safely handle, clean, assemble, function-test, and package surgical instruments and medical equipment.

We are seeking Practicum Advisors to support and mentor students during their practicum placements. As a Practicum Advisor, you will:

  • Support students over a 10-week practicum placement.
  • Meet/check in with assigned student(s) weekly to guide, observe, and provide feedback on their performance.
  • Ensure students are meeting defined competencies and professional standards.
  • Communicate progress, successes, and concerns to the practicum coordinator at Lethbridge Polytechnic.
  • Provide feedback, coaching, and guidance to help students develop the knowledge, skills, and safety awareness needed for medical device reprocessing.
